Искусственный интеллект (ИИ) продолжает стремительно развиваться, открывая новые горизонты и возможности в различных сферах науки и техники. Одним из самых революционных направлений является создание адаптивных нейросетей, способных самостоятельно улучшать свои алгоритмы без постоянного вмешательства человека. Такие системы не просто анализируют и обучаются на основе исходных данных, но и динамически модифицируют собственную структуру и параметры, обеспечивая высокую степень автономности и эффективности.
Разработка подобных адаптивных нейросетей трансформирует подход к созданию интеллектуальных систем, позволяя значительно сократить время и ресурсы на их оптимизацию. Это особенно актуально в условиях быстро меняющихся данных и сложных задач, когда традиционные методы требуют частых корректировок и перенастроек специалистами. Данная статья подробно рассмотрит концепцию адаптивных нейросетей, основные методы их самосовершенствования и перспективы применения в различных областях.
Что такое адаптивные нейросети и почему они важны
Адаптивные нейросети — это разновидность искусственных нейронных сетей, которые имеют способность самостоятельно изменять свои параметры и структуру в процессе работы. В отличие от классических моделей, где обучение завершается на этапе тренировки с фиксированными параметрами, адаптивные сети способны непрерывно оптимизировать свои веса, архитектуру и алгоритмы во время эксплуатации.
Важность таких сетей обусловлена необходимостью повышения гибкости и устойчивости интеллектуальных систем. В реальных условиях данные часто непредсказуемы и динамичны, а задачи — с разными требованиями. Адаптивный подход позволяет системе «подстраиваться» под текущую среду, улучшая качество результатов и минимизируя ошибки без вмешательства инженеров.
Преимущества самосовершенствующихся нейросетей
- Автономность: способность улучшать алгоритмы без постоянного контроля и ручной корректировки.
- Устойчивость: адаптация к изменениям входных данных, среды и задач без потери эффективности.
- Снижение затрат: уменьшение необходимости в регулярном участии разработчиков и специалистов по обучению моделей.
- Повышение точности: непрерывное улучшение качества предсказаний и распознавания благодаря самообучению и оптимизации.
Основные методы разработки адаптивных нейросетей
Процесс создания адаптивных нейросетей основан на сочетании различных методик и алгоритмов машинного обучения, которые позволяют сетям самостоятельно выявлять и внедрять улучшения. Среди них ключевую роль играют методы онлайн-обучения, эволюционные алгоритмы и механизм обратной связи.
Такая комплексность обеспечивает гибкость в реагировании на новых данных и задачах, а также позволяет не только подстраивать параметры, но и вносить структурные изменения — например, добавлять или удалять нейроны, менять связь между слоями.
Онлайн-обучение и непрерывное обновление
Онлайн-обучение предполагает, что нейросеть учится в режиме реального времени, поступая новые данные. В результате обновляются веса и параметры на основе новых примеров, что позволяет оперативно реагировать на изменения в характеристиках входных данных.
Такие системы особенно эффективны для обработки потоковой информации, например, в финансовом секторе, телекоме или аналитике больших данных. Постоянное обновление снижает риск устаревания моделей и повышает адаптивность.
Эволюционные и генетические алгоритмы
Эволюционные алгоритмы имитируют процесс естественного отбора, позволяя нейросети автоматически изменять свою структуру и параметры в поисках оптимального решения. Множественные варианты сети сравнительно оцениваются и отбираются лучшие, которые затем подвергаются мутациям и скрещиванию.
Этот подход эффективен для задач, где структура модели играет критическую роль, и традиционные методы оптимизации недостаточны для достижения максимальной производительности.
Механизмы обратной связи и самооценки
Для самостоятельного улучшения необходимо, чтобы нейросеть могла анализировать свои ошибки и определять области для усовершенствования. Таким образом, используется механизм обратной связи, который обеспечивает постоянный мониторинг качества решений и подстройку процессов обучения.
Это может быть реализовано, например, через встроенные метрики производительности, которые позволяют системе самостоятельно регулировать степень изменений и обеспечивают баланс между адаптацией и стабильностью.
Технические аспекты и архитектурные решения
Разработка адаптивных нейросетей требует принятия сложных архитектурных решений и внедрения продвинутых технических приемов. Важными характеристиками являются динамическая перестройка топологии сети, управление памятью и вычислительными ресурсами, а также интеграция модулей для самоконтроля.
Кроме того, существенно совершенствуются методы регуляризации и предотвращения переобучения, так как частые обновления могут привести к нестабильности и потере обобщающей способности модели.
Динамические архитектуры сетей
| Тип архитектуры | Описание | Преимущества |
|---|---|---|
| Нейросети с эволюционной структурой | Автоматическое добавление/удаление нейронов и связей | Адаптация к новым задачам, оптимизация ресурсов |
| Сети с элементами внимания (Attention) | Автоматический выбор значимых признаков | Повышение точности и скорости обработки данных |
| Гибридные модели | Сочетание разных типов нейронных сетей и алгоритмов | Широкие возможности адаптации и универсальность |
Управление ресурсами и оптимизация вычислений
В адаптивных системах часто задействованы сложные вычислительные процессы, требующие эффективного распределения памяти и процессорного времени. Для этого применяются методы компрессии моделей, квантования весов и распределённых вычислений.
Кроме того, важно реализовывать механизмы контроля за степенью модификации параметров, чтобы избежать излишней стоимости вычислительных ресурсов и обеспечить устойчивое функционирование в реальном времени.
Области применения и перспективы развития
Адаптивные нейросети открывают новые возможности для широкого круга отраслей: от медицины и робототехники до финансов и индустрии развлечений. Их способность к самоусовершенствованию позволяет создавать интеллектуальные системы, способные эффективно работать в меняющихся условиях и разрешать сложные нестандартные задачи.
В будущем ожидается дальнейшее внедрение таких моделей в области искусственного интеллекта на стыке с биоинформатикой, автономными системами и цифровыми помощниками, что приведёт к качественному скачку в развитии технологий.
Примеры использования в реальных условиях
- Медицинская диагностика: адаптивные сети анализируют новые данные пациентов и улучшают точность постановки диагноза без дополнительных ручных корректировок.
- Автономные транспортные средства: системы автоматически подстраиваются под меняющиеся дорожные условия и стили поведения водителей.
- Финансовый сектор: адаптация торговых алгоритмов в реальном времени с учётом динамики рынка и трендов.
Технологические вызовы и задачи
Несмотря на очевидные преимущества, создание полностью автономных и самосовершенствующихся нейросетей сталкивается с рядом вызовов: обеспечение безопасности изменений, предотвращение деградации модели, интерпретируемость результатов и контроль качества.
Также остаётся важной задачей разработка этических норм и правил использования таких систем, чтобы предотвратить нежелательное поведение и обеспечить доверие пользователей.
Заключение
Адаптивные нейросети, способные самостоятельно улучшать свои алгоритмы без непосредственного вмешательства человека, представляют собой важный этап эволюции искусственного интеллекта. Они открывают новые возможности для создания высокоэффективных, гибких и устойчивых интеллектуальных систем, способных оперативно реагировать на изменяющиеся условия и задачи.
Современные методы, такие как онлайн-обучение, эволюционные алгоритмы и механизмы обратной связи, позволяют создавать модели с открытой структурой и возможностью динамического обновления. Однако разработка таких систем требует решения сложных технических и этических вопросов, связанных с контролем, безопасностью и интерпретируемостью.
В перспективе адаптивные нейросети окажут значительное влияние на самые разные сферы — от медицины и транспорта до экономики и науки — и станут ключевым элементом будущих интеллектуальных технологий. Постоянное развитие этой области гарантирует, что уже в ближайшие годы мы увидим новые прорывы и внедрения, трансформирующие наше представление о возможностях машинного обучения и искусственного интеллекта.
Что такое адаптивные нейросети и чем они отличаются от обычных нейросетей?
Адаптивные нейросети — это модели искусственного интеллекта, которые способны самостоятельно модифицировать свои структуры и алгоритмы в процессе обучения или эксплуатации без необходимости полного вмешательства человека. В отличие от традиционных нейросетей, требующих ручной настройки и обновления, адаптивные нейросети могут динамически улучшать свою производительность и приспосабливаться к новым данным и условиям.
Какие преимущества дают адаптивные нейросети для развития искусственного интеллекта?
Адаптивные нейросети повышают эффективность и автономность систем ИИ, позволяя им быстрее и точнее реагировать на изменения в окружающей среде. Это снижает необходимость вмешательства разработчиков, ускоряет процесс обучения и способствует созданию более устойчивых и универсальных моделей, способных работать в разнообразных и непредсказуемых ситуациях.
Какие технологии и методы используются для разработки самосовершенствующихся нейросетей?
Для создания адаптивных нейросетей применяются методы машинного обучения с подкреплением, эволюционные алгоритмы, нейроэволюция и метаобучение. Эти технологии позволяют нейросетям самостоятельно оптимизировать архитектуру, параметры и алгоритмы обучения на основе обратной связи и анализа результата, без необходимости постоянного руководства со стороны человека.
Какие потенциальные риски и вызовы связаны с использованием нейросетей, способных самостоятельно улучшать свои алгоритмы?
Основными рисками являются потеря контроля над процессом обучения, непредсказуемое поведение моделей, а также проблемы с безопасностью и этикой. Автоматическое изменение алгоритмов может привести к нежелательным результатам или ошибкам, которые сложно отследить и исправить, что требует разработки надежных систем мониторинга и ограничений.
В каких сферах уже применяются адаптивные нейросети и какие перспективы их использования в будущем?
Адаптивные нейросети применяются в робототехнике, автономных транспортных средствах, системах рекомендаций, медицинской диагностике и финансовом анализе. В будущем их использование может значительно расшириться, обеспечивая более интеллектуальные, гибкие и автономные системы, способные эффективно решать сложные задачи в реальном времени и в изменяющихся условиях.